Job Description:Reporting to the VP - Chief Compliance and Privacy Officer, the Compliance Program Manager supports the development, implementation, and ongoing monitoring of the Compliance Program for John Muir Health, John Muir Physician Network, John Muir Behavioral Health, and John Muir Health Foundation (collectively, “JMH”). The Compliance Program Manager is a key contributor to the Compliance Department’s goals and objectives and helps ensure the effective day-to-day operation of the Compliance Program.

Education:

  • BA/BS degree in business, healthcare administration, health information management, public health, or a related field required. Relevant experience in a related healthcare or compliance may be substituted for education on a year-for-year basis.

Experience:

  • 3–5 years of healthcare compliance experience required, preferably in a hospital, health system, or other provider setting. This includes direct experience supporting a healthcare compliance program required, including experience with compliance operations, policy implementation, auditing and monitoring, investigations, regulatory education, corrective action follow-up, or related program activities

Certification/Licensures:

  • CHC – Certified Healthcare Compliance  - Required or ability to obtain certification within twelve (12) months of acceptance of assignment

Skills:

  • Superior interpersonal and organizational skills.

  • Superior oral and written communication skills.

  • Strong organizational, documentation and tracking skills.

  • Attention to detail and ability to follow established processes.

  • Ability to manage multiple and often competing projects and/or demands, while adhering to strict timelines.

  • Ability to motivate, develop and direct people to accomplish objectives.

  • Ability to act with confidence, build trust and credibility and collaborative relationships.

  • Ability to escalate issues appropriately and work within defined authority.

  • Proficient with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int and Copilot or similar tools.
